+#ifdef ACPI_DEBUGGER
+/*******************************************************************************
+ *
+ * FUNCTION:    acpi_db_close_debug_file
+ *
+ * PARAMETERS:  None
+ *
+ * RETURN:      None
+ *
+ * DESCRIPTION: If open, close the current debug output file
+ *
+ ******************************************************************************/
+void acpi_db_close_debug_file(void)
+{
+
+#ifdef ACPI_APPLICATION
+
+       if (acpi_gbl_debug_file) {
+               fclose(acpi_gbl_debug_file);
+               acpi_gbl_debug_file = NULL;
+               acpi_gbl_db_output_to_file = FALSE;
+               acpi_os_printf("Debug output file %s closed\n",
+                              acpi_gbl_db_debug_filename);
+       }
+#endif
+}
+
+/*******************************************************************************
+ *
+ * FUNCTION:    acpi_db_open_debug_file
+ *
+ * PARAMETERS:  name                - Filename to open
+ *
+ * RETURN:      None
+ *
+ * DESCRIPTION: Open a file where debug output will be directed.
+ *
+ ******************************************************************************/
+
+void acpi_db_open_debug_file(char *name)
+{
+
+#ifdef ACPI_APPLICATION
+
+       acpi_db_close_debug_file();
+       acpi_gbl_debug_file = fopen(name, "w+");
+       if (!acpi_gbl_debug_file) {
+               acpi_os_printf("Could not open debug file %s\n", name);
+               return;
+       }
+
+       acpi_os_printf("Debug output file %s opened\n", name);
+       strncpy(acpi_gbl_db_debug_filename, name,
+               sizeof(acpi_gbl_db_debug_filename));
+       acpi_gbl_db_output_to_file = TRUE;
+
+#endif
+}
+#endif
